Transaction 585ddee8097020643195a6a7f18871a2bb2672fc2122ab6dc35b5dfc9387074a

1 Input
2 Outputs
  • 585ddee8097020643195a6a7f18871a2bb2672fc2122ab6dc35b5dfc9387074a:0
  • value  10855628
    address  12A86Evg26qQtUB8qvWsvXTLtvBL4pDWf7
  • 585ddee8097020643195a6a7f18871a2bb2672fc2122ab6dc35b5dfc9387074a:1
  • value  1206179
    address  1DboeepZE1kmNA8D17qL1hdNtkavn8phat